About 17,100,000 results
Open links in new tab
  1. The biggest name in Canada’s race to replace Justin Trudeau: Donald Trump

  2. Carney, Freeland lead Liberal MP endorsements as leadership race ...

  3. The race to lead Canada’s Liberal Party hinges on handling Trump

  4. Gould says Trump won't listen to journalists and central bankers …

  5. Liberal leadership front-runners promise dollar-for-dollar tariff ...

  6. Canada’s Liberal leadership race: Who’s running to replace Justin ...

  7. Canada’s Liberal Party in search of a new leader while dealing …

  8. Freeland pitches herself as tested Trump negotiator, as protesters ...

  9. Who could replace Justin Trudeau to lead Canada’s Liberal Party?

  10. Justin Trudeau’s Trying to Save His Party. Is He Hurting Canada?

  11. Some results have been removed